Comcast Spotlight Boosts Efficiency With OpenTV Tool

Ad Sales Unit Claims Significant Reduction in Time to Enter Orders

By Todd Spangler -- Multichannel News, 12/10/2007 4:46:00 AM

Comcast Spotlight claimed it has improved efficiency of sales personnel using software provided by OpenTV – cutting an order process that used to take 3 hours down to 5 minutes.

OpenTV’s Eclipse Web Services 1.6 product, launched earlier this year, is currently deployed in five Comcast Spotlight markets serving 14 large DMAs.

The software lets Comcast Spotlight account executives and sales assistants quickly check avails for their campaigns. Users can make adjustments in the sales system and export orders directly into the traffic system, saving “significant amounts of time,” according to the companies.

The OpenTV Web services system "allows our users to be more efficient and productive, and they are now able to focus their time on selling, and not spending so much on clearing inventory," Comcast Spotlight vice president of information systems and technology Bob Rittler said, in a statement.

Comcast Spotlight, based in New York, has a presence in almost 90 markets with approximately 30 million owned and represented subscribers.
